About Russell MacGregor Jeffords
Russell MacGregor Jeffords is a scholar working on Paleontology, Geology and Ecological Modeling, having authored 11 papers that have together received 417 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Paleontology and Stratigraphy of Fossils (3 papers),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(2 papers) and Cephalopods and Marine Biology (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Paleontology (259 citations), Oceanography (180 citations) and Atmospheric Science (224 citations). Russell MacGregor Jeffords has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Raymond C. Moore, James L. Lamb, R. M. Stainforth, Hanspeter Luterbacher, J. H. Beard and D. H. Jones.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Paleontology, Micropaleontology and KU ScholarWorks (The University of Kansas).
